Converting a time string to std :: time_t using std :: get_time: incorrect result

I am trying to sort photos in chronological order. Therefore, I extract time as a string from EXIF ​​data, which I then convert to std::time_t. However, sometimes I get the wrong result. I reduced the problem to this minimal example. It has three time lines: one second:

#include <vector>
#include <string>
#include <iostream>
#include <ctime>
#include <iomanip>
#include <sstream>

int main()
{
  std::vector<std::string> vec;

  vec.push_back("2016:07:30 09:27:06");
  vec.push_back("2016:07:30 09:27:07");
  vec.push_back("2016:07:30 09:27:08");

  for ( auto & i : vec )
  {
    struct std::tm tm;
    std::istringstream iss;
    iss.str(i);
    iss >> std::get_time(&tm,"%Y:%m:%d %H:%M:%S");

    std::time_t time = mktime(&tm);

    std::cout << i << " time = " << time << std::endl;
  }
}

Compiled with clang++ -std=c++14 test.cpp.

Exit:

2016:07:30 09:27:06 time = 1469867226
2016:07:30 09:27:07 time = 1469863627
2016:07:30 09:27:08 time = 1469863628

What is clearly wrong, they should be 1separated from each other, which is true only for the last two?

Edit

Since an error appears in clang std::get_time(s std::put_time), here is my version information:

$ clang --version
Apple LLVM version 8.1.0 (clang-802.0.42)
Target: x86_64-apple-darwin16.7.0
Thread model: posix
InstalledDir: /Applications/Xcode.app/Contents/Developer/Toolchains/XcodeDefault.xctoolchain/usr/bin
